3.75 Stars. This is not your fluffy romance book. This tugs on your heartstrings and can get pretty deep in some of its themes. I really enjoyed Greenberg’s writing, although there were some points where the metaphors and flowery language got a little too out of hand. As for the story, one of the MMC’s is too perfect to even be believable and then the other MMC kind of sucks, so I don’t know what took the FMC so long to choose – c’mon girl, the choice is obvious. It shouldn’t have taken 300+ pages to figure it out (although the FMC kind of sucks too, so maybe that’s why it took so long). Speaking of, justice for Cecily, she didn’t deserve that shit. Lastly, and this is a me problem, but I don’t care for song lyrics in books, and there were so dang many in this.
